Abstract
PURPOSE:To perform the salt-to-fresh water conversion readily and inexpensively by sinking the reverse osmosis modules having reverse osmosis membranes into the sea water of the specific depth, communicating the permeating water side to the atmosphere and letting reverse osmosis be done by water pressure. CONSTITUTION:The tubular reverse osmosis modules 1 having reverse osmosis membranes are mounted in multiplicity to the lower end portion at water depth 250m or more of the atmospheric communicating and water collecting pipe 1 supported to the frame work 10 installed to the sea bottom G and a water well 12 is disposed to the bottom lower of the pipe 11. The pump 13 provided in the water well 12 is connected to the water feed pipe 14 communicating with the water storage tank (not illustrated) on the ground. The sea water permeates through the modules 1 under water pressure, whereby it is desalted to fresh water. This desalted water is accumulated in the water well 12 through the water collecting pipe 11. The collected freshed water is transported by a pump 13 to a desired place through the water feed pipe 14.
